About Guy Stevens

I am the Chief Executive and Founder of the Manta Trust, a UK and US (Action for Mantas) registered charity dedicated to the conservation of manta and devil rays (mobulids), with collaborative projects in over 25 countries. I have spent the last 15 years studying mobulids all over the world, and I'm one of the foremost experts on these species. After completing a degree in Marine Biology and Coastal Ecology at the University of Plymouth in the UK, I moved to the Maldives, where I founded the Maldivian Manta Ray Project in 2005. After 11 years of research, I completed my PhD on the world’s largest population of reef manta rays at the end of 2016.My conservation efforts in the Maldives have led to the creation of several marine protected areas at key manta aggregations sites, most notably at Hanifaru Bay. Internationally, I am part of a team which has driven the conservation of mobulids forward, resulting in the listing of all manta and devil rays in the Appendices of the Convention on the Conservation of Migratory Species of Wild Animals (the Bonn Convention) and the Convention on International Trade in Endangered Species of Wild Fauna and Flora (CITES). In recognition of my contribution to ocean conservation, in 2015 I received an Ocean Award for my work on manta rays, and in 2017 I was awarded the UK Prime Minister’s Points of Light Award. I am the author of two books; the award-winning MANTA – The Secret Life of Devil Rays, published in 2017, and the Guide to Manta and Devil Rays of the World, published in 2018.As well as my work on manta rays, I have worked as a specialist marine biology consultant for the Four Seasons Resorts in the Maldives since 2003. I have extensive knowledge of the marine world in the Maldives archipelago and the wider tropical oceans, and each year I lead educational and research focused dive expeditions globally through Manta Expeditions (www.mantaexpeditions.com).
